City Vineyard offers a stunning waterfront dining experience in New York City, blending a restaurant, wine bar, and event venue. Located at 233 West St, it features indoor seating, a patio, and a rooftop with panoramic views of the Hudson River. Known for its American cuisine, house wines, and dog-friendly atmosphere, it's perfect for sunset dinners, weekend hangs, weddings, and private events. With a 4.3/5 rating from over 2,300 reviews, guests praise the chill vibe, friendly service, and dishes like the CV Burger and truffle fries.

What a phenomenal Sunday evening we had, having the back rooftop patio almost all to ourselves for my partner’s birthday! And whoever was the Black gentleman who worked upstairs keeping the back of the rooftop patio clean and organized — I’m not sure I’d ever seen someone so dedicated to his shift. We were a group of 13 and so we put some of the tables together (it is first-come, first-served on the upstairs patio). He pointed out where we could grab more chairs if needed, and asked us to leave the remainder of the tables for other people. Then whenever people came upstairs and got seated, he would arrange the remaining tables and chairs so there would always be an open spot for whoever would arrive next! There is no waiter service upstairs, but he did also offer to take our trash to help keep our table neat. We stayed for a few hours long after the gorgeous, fiery sunset was gone. What a chill and memorable location! You can order food to-go from the dinner menu at the downstairs bar and bring it up in a cardboard container. Amongst the table, we had truffle fries, the burger, the lobster roll, and some flatbreads…. It all looked and tasted great! Additionally, the one bartender downstairs was so friendly as well!
